# Waveform Preview Runbook

Soundloft's preview service renders audio waveforms for uploaded clips. If previews come back blank, check the render worker pool first — it starves under long uploads. Restart workers one at a time; never drain the whole pool during business hours. Failed renders retry three times, then land in the dead-letter topic. New folks: read the on-call notes before touching anything. The service starts with these configuration values.

config for tagep-yajef:
ulawyn:
  log_level: error
  metrics_host: metrics.ulawyn.lumiclabs.internal
  pin: 0564
  pool_size: 32

- [ ] Step 7: Archive cold storage buckets (Glacierline tier). Confirm both ceremony witnesses are present, verify bucket manifests match the Oxbow ledger, then seal the archive key shares. Plugin authors may observe but not handle shares. Once sealed, the archive index itself is encrypted and can only be reopened with the passphrase below.

vault phrase of badup-hahig = tamael-aldael-kelmir-istael-fenok-istwyn-tamius-jorath-oliion

Ticket: Staging env misconfigured for Siftgate bloom filter

The bloom layer in front of the Pellet KV store is rejecting all lookups in staging because the env file was copied from the dev template without credentials. False-positive tuning values are fine; only the auth line is missing. To unblock the weekly demo, the Pellet admission secret must be set on the following line.

env line for yaguf-fajop: LEDGER_TOKEN13=fb08984397349

## Deploying the Gatewick Proctor Queue

Deploys are pretty painless: push to main, wait for the pipeline, then watch the queue drain dashboard for five minutes. If candidates pile up mid-exam, roll back first and ask questions later — the queue replays safely. Everything the workers care about lives in one config block, shown here for reference.

settings of bafof-yagef:
JOROX_PIN=8740
JOROX_TENANT=pelox
JOROX_METRICS_HOST=metrics.jorox.qorvelworks.internal
JOROX_SEAL=seal_c78f63c1
JOROX_STANDBY_TEAM=norax